Hey Everyone,

I just got my hands on PHP Nuke 6.0 via my web server, and it gets installed on it's own, I just have to click a button, and bang, it is done. But I want to upgrade to 6.5

I have downloaded the .tar.gz file from phpnuke.org and uncompressed it onto my HDD. I am officially lost from there. I have tried many different wayz to update it, and no luck. I have tried finding documentation that makes sense, but it all either makes no sense, or doesnt explain enough in detail.

So, anyone who can help resolve this little problem I am having would be greatly appreciated, and I would like to get it updated, and move on from there...

As it says in the INSTALL:

Copy the files over your 6.0 files.
Put the upgrade60-65.php file in the same directory as config.php an run it,
Done.

If you are running the phpBB port in your Nuke6.0 site and wish to upgrade to Nuke6.5 or higher. You MUST use the nukebbsql Upgrade script found here
http://www.nukecops.com/downloads-file-35-details-nukeBBsql.php.html

Otherwise use the upgrade file Raven specified.

OK Kindred. The VERY FIRST thing you need to do is BACKUP your exisiting Files and Database.
Next upload ALL the Nuke6.5 files and overwrite your exisiting ones.
Then run the appropriate upgrade script.
